Flexible liquid helium transfer line (Tcryo®)
Tcryo® is a new generation of ultra thermal insulation flexible liquid helium transfer line, typically equipped with built-in needle valve for controlling liquid helium flow, cryopump and ice filter, and utilizing ultra-insulated multi-layer insulation materials. It features lower outgassing rates, superior insulation performance, and optimized thermal insulation support design, resulting in reduced heat leakage, higher liquid helium transmission efficiency, and extended maintenance-free intervals. Depending on the application scenario, it is categorized into two types: continuous liquid helium transfer lines (Tcryo-NE) and high-throughput transfer lines (Tcryo-HT).
1. Continuous liquid helium transmission line (Tcryo-NE)
Continuous liquid helium transfer line (Tcryo-NE) enables the uninterrupted and low-flow transmission of liquid helium, making it the preferred choice for continuous flow cryogenic cryostats. In addition to its excellent thermal insulation performance, it features lightweight and flexible characteristics, resulting in lower torque applied to the continuous flow cryogenic cryostats, which significantly enhances its stability.
